Q: Does the Farecurve ticket-pricing experiment expose anything sensitive?

A: Short answer: no. Variant assignment is a salted hash of an anonymous session token, prices are computed server-side, and the raw experiment logs strip buyer details before landing in the warehouse. The only thing a client sees is its own final price. If you want to audit the bucketing logic, the assignment spec and data-retention notes are on the internal page here.

operations page: https://jenkins.zemvarcloud.local/job/merge_requests/repo/build/73930b4b30f0a8ed

Quarterly Planning Note — Sales Leads, Brastow & Hale

The Kettleford office will close at quarter end. Accounts handled there move to the Ordale hub; territory maps update next week. No headcount reductions are planned, and travel budgets adjust accordingly. Expect minor disruption to renewal calls in that region. The confidential note on related business plans follows below.

confidential, kagep-kahof: Druokax Systems plans to lower the Ulaath list price by 53 percent in March.

- [ ] **Step 7: Breaker override escrow.** After sealing the signing keys for the Tallgrove upstream API circuit breaker, confirm the support team can force the breaker open during a full outage. The override bundle lives in the sealed escrow drawer and is useless without its unlock phrase. Two ceremony witnesses must initial this step before proceeding. The escrow bundle is decrypted with the recovery passphrase that follows.

vault phrase of kahip-kahop = holath-quenmir

## Formula sandbox tuning

User-supplied formulas in Gridmoor execute inside a restricted interpreter with hard ceilings on time, memory, and call depth. Reviewers should confirm any change to these ceilings is justified in the PR description, since raising them widens the abuse surface. Defaults were chosen from production traces. The current limits are as follows.

limits module of tafog-fawip:
WEIGHTS = {
    "julix": 57,
    "lamys": 992,
    "kasvan": 209,
    "quenok": 750,
    "alddor": 259,
    "oliath": 1009,
    "wenix": 815,
}